The latest inducement to get undocumented immigrants to leave the US is one that is unlikely to sit well with much of President Donald Trump’s working class MAGA base: a parting gift of $1,000 and a plane ticket home.

But news of this arrangement has been mostly eclipsed by the second part of the self-deportation strategy: The threat, for anyone who fails to self-deport, of being sent to a country with a terrible human rights record.
